FTO's at drags
Hi guys,
Well I entered my car into drags last night with a friend.
I did a 15.8 second time through (it was my first time doing it ever last night) and I feel I should've been doing a quicker time (my car is stock engine except a redline foam filter and front/rearsway bars).
For some reason, when I'd change from 2nd to 3rd...it wouldn't go into gear? This was while I was changing gear in mivec. Did I just miss the gear altogether and hit between 1st and 3rd? Or it just doesn't like it while in mivec? I got no idea.
Anyway, point is....what can I do to improve my time with the most beneficial modifications. I want to keep it N/A.
What time is a FTO meant to run stock anyway?
Much appreciated,
Aaron.

My must have mod list for your FTO
1. Fix up your CAI - pipe to TB + box it and get better flow from the front bar $300
2. Exhaust - Hi Flow Cat, Muffler. ~$1000 installed
3. Fuel Pressure regulator (optional) ~300
4. Piggyback or say the Unichip - or simply a SAFC - even out the mixture at least $1200 installed(depending on which one u get)
5. Extractors & flex pipe $700-800 installed
6. Suspension (sway bars and bushes + shocks and spring upgrade) $2000 installed
(assumed that some1 else will being doing the install)
This will get you going...then Tb/Manifold upgrade etc
